Cluny Capital Corp. Announces Its Annual and Special Meeting of Shareholders to Be Held on March 31, 2021

TORONTO, March 02, 2021 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Cluny Capital Corp. (the “Company” or “Cluny”) (TSXV:CLN.H), a capital pool company pursuant to Policy 2.4 (“Policy 2.4”) of the TSX Venture Exchange (the “Exchange”), is pleased to announce that its Annual and Special Meeting of Shareholders (the “Meeting”) will be held on Wednesday, March 31, 2021 at 10:00 a.m. EST. The Meeting will be held via a Zoom teleconference and entry will be limited to registered shareholders and/or their duly appointed proxyholders.

In addition to the election of directors and the appointment of auditors, at the Meeting, the Company will seek shareholder approval for certain matters in connection with the Company’s business combination transaction with Teonan Biomedical Inc., as disclosed in more detail in the Company’s press release dated November 30, 2020. This includes approval to (i) change the name of the Company to “The Good Shroom Co Inc.” (Les bons Champignons inc); (ii) continue the Company from an Ontario corporation to a corporation under the Canada Business Corporations Act; and (iii) consolidate the Company’s issued and outstanding common shares on the basis of one (1) post consolidation common share of the Company for each three (3) pre-consolidation common shares.

In addition, in accordance with recent amendments by the Exchange to the capital pool company (“CPC”) program and Policy 2.4, which became effective on January 1, 2021 (the “New CPC Policy”), the Company will be seeking disinterested shareholder approval to amend the escrow release conditions of the Company’s CPC escrow agreements dated October 31, 2012 and June 6, 2018 (the “Escrow Agreements”) affecting 2,300,000 common shares (766,666 assuming completion of the consolidation). The proposed amendments to the Escrow Agreements would result in the Company’s escrowed common shares to be subject to an 18 month escrow release schedule detailed in the New CPC Policy, instead of the current 36 month escrow release schedule. The amendments to the Escrow Agreements are subject to the approval of the Exchange.
